Description
This is the tale of a kingdom once saved
by Princess Lil Cap and Sir Hud the Brave...
Princess Lil Cap and Sir Hud the Brave live a happy, peaceful life in a beautiful castle. But what happens when they're betrayed by an old friend and banished from the kingdom? To get back home, they'll learn how to improvise, accept help from others, embrace bravery, and believe in themselves.

About the Author
Cappy McGarr is an Emmy-nominated co-founder of the Mark Twain Prize for American Humor and the Library of Congress Gershwin Prize for Popular Song. He's one of few people to be appointed to the Kennedy Center by two different presidents. His writing has been published in the New York Times, Politico, and USA Today. His memoir, The Man Who Made Mark Twain Famous, is available at retailers everywhere.Chandler Dean is a Brooklyn-based comedian and speechwriter whose satire has been featured in The New Yorker, McSweeney's, Reductress, and Hard Drive. He is a director at the speechwriting firm West Wing Writers, where he co-leads the firm's humor practice. He has previously worked for The Late Show with Stephen Colbert, Late Night with Seth Meyers, and Full Frontal with Samantha Bee.
